a) replace x with -10 and solve:
-6(-10)-3 = 60-3 = 57
f(-10) = 57
b) replace f(x) with 93 and solve for x:
93 = -6x-3
Add 3 to each side:
96 = -6x
Divide each side by -6:
x = -16
The input value is -16
